    Filson Bag Thread: With Pictures

    Just for clarification... the pockets in the front, zippered compartment of the 258 are a mix of closed and open-bottom. There are 4 various-sized open-bottom pockets and 2 closed-bottom pockets. 1 of the closed-bottom pockets is fairly large and would easily hold an external HD and/or a mouse...
